Stupid question....
Im having to park the nice new bike for at leats the next 3 months maby longer. Is there anything i should do to keep it in top condition. Its stored in a garage so weather is not a problem. Should i disconnect the battery or anything like that??? |

Try and jack the tyres off the ground,and drain the carbs if it has carbs.Fuel stabliser in a full tank of petrol and get an Optimate.Lube the chain up.
